Moscardón, Teruel Province and driving Home to Granada Province, Spain.

A Mornings Butterfly hunting with Andy, Kath and Mick.

Mick, Andy and Kath.
I met the others at a bar just on the edge of town where we had a coffee before we headed out to the meadows at Moscardón where we parked, crossed the road and walked the meadows down as far as the concrete Troughs, out in the more open areas we found several Azure Chalkhill Blues (Lysandra caelestissima), Southern Gatekeeper (Pyronia cecilia), Safflower Skipper (Pyrgus carthami), Iberian Marbled White (Melanargia lachesis), False (Arethusana arethusa), Great Banded (Kanetisa circe) and Rock Grayling (Hipparchi alcyone), Spanish Heath (Coenonympha glycerion iphioides) and then a very nice Iberian Sooty Copper (Lycaena bleusei).

Bird wise we saw and heard European Bee-eater (Abejaruco Común / Merops apiaster), Iberian Green (Pito Real / Picus sharpei) and Great Spotted Woodpecker (Pico Picapinos / Dendrocopos major), Golden Oriole (Oropéndola / Oriolus oriolus), Blackbird (Mirlo Común / Turdus merula), Robin (Petirrojo Europeo / Erithacus rubecula), Bonelli's Warbler (Mosquitero Papialbo / Phylloscopus bonelli), Raven (Cuervo / Corvus corax), Carrion Crow (Corneja Negra / Corvus corone), Common Crossbill (Piquituerto Común / Loxia curvirostra), Long-tailed (Mito / Aegithalos caudatus) and Crested Tit (Herrerillo Capuchino / Parus cristatus), Mistle Thrush (Zorzal Charlo / Turdus viscivorus) and Short-toed Treecreeper (Agateador Común / Certhia brachydactyla).

As we moved in amongst the bushes and trees we picked up Adonis (Lysandra bellargus) and Common / Southern Blue (Polyommatus icarus / celina), Southern Brown Argus (Aricia cramera), Silver-spotted Skipper (Hesperia comma), Comma (Polygonum c-album), High Brown (Fabriciana adippe), Silver-Washed (Argynnis paphia) and a very tatty Twin-spot fritillary (Brenthis hecate), Queen of Spain (Issoria lathonia), Southern White Admiral (Limenitis reducta), Bath White (Pontia daplidice), Clouded Yellow (Colias corceua), Berger's Clouded Yellow (Colias alfacariensis), Wood White (Leptidea sinapis), Meadow Brown (Maniola jurtina) and Long-tailed Blue (Lampides baeticus).

As we walked back up towards the cars I added
Wall Brown (Lasiommata megera), Red-underwing Skipper (Spialia sertorius), Small Copper (Lycaena phlaeas), Gatekeeper (Pyronia tithonus), False Ilex Hairstreak (Satyrium esculi), Iberian Scarce Swallowtail (Iphiclides feisthameli), Knapweed Fritillary (Melitaea phoebe), Common Wall Lizard (Podarcis muralis), Large Psammodromus (Psammodromus algirus), Barn Swallow (Golondrina Común / Hirundo rustica), Cirl Bunting (Escribano Soteno / Emberiza cirlus), Firecrest (Reyezuelo Listado / Regulus ignicapillus), Blackcap (Curruca Capirotada / Sylvia atricailla), Blue Tit (Herrerillo Común / Parus caeruleus), Common Chaffinch (Pinzón Vulgar / Fringilla coelebs), Goldfinch (Jilguero / Carduelis carduelis), Serin (Verdecillo / Serinus serinus) and Song Thrush (Zorzal Común / Turdus philomelos).

We reached the cars and we went just up the road to a spot Karen, Bob and I found a few days earlier where we had seen some good Dragonfly species as well as a great number of Puddling Blues which today included
Azure Chalkhill, Damon (Polyommatus damon) and Oberthur's Anomalous Blue (Polyommatus fabressei) as well as Small (Thymelicus sylvestris) and Red-underwing Skipper and a single Small Pincertail (Onychogomphus forcipatus).

I wanted to get back home at a reasonable time so I sad goodbye to Andy, Kath and Mick and left them with the Blues which I know they enjoyed and walked back to my car, up by the pools I again saw Azure Damselfly (Coenagrion puella), Keeled Skimmer (Orthetrum coerulescens), Southern Hawker (Aeshna cyanea) and Common Spreadwing (Lestes Sponsa) before setting off South and Home after a great trip.
